
For Luke Kirby, ‘Étoile’ Was a History Lesson

After charming audiences as New York City comedian Lenny Bruce in The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el, Luke Kirby returns this week as a new New York star: Jack McMillan, director of the (fictional) Metropolitan Ballet Theater.
Kirby’s protagonist leads Étoile, Prime Video’s ballet dramedy from Maisel co-creators Amy Sherman-Palladino and Daniel Palladino (the wife-husband team also made Gilmore Girls and Bunheads). In a last-ditch attempt to spark ticket sales, Jack agrees to trade his company’s biggest stars with France’s (also fictional) Le Ballet National, helmed by Charlotte Gainsbourg’s Genevieve Lavigne.
Étoile’s eight episodes are stuffed with whimsical characters, sharp humor and an impressive cast of real dancers and great ballet. Through it all, Jack and Genvieve’s fight to save their beloved art form becomes the show’s most central duet.
